
(IC) DaBaby keeps his momentum rolling with the release of "POP DAT THANG (REMIX)," tapping a powerhouse lineup featuring GloRilla, Yung Miami, and rising voice YKNIECE. The remix builds on the energy of the original record, bringing together distinct styles and perspectives for a refreshed take on one of the year's biggest records.
On the remix, each featured artist brings a unique presence to the track. Memphis CMG superstar GloRilla, known for her GRAMMY-nominated rise and high-energy delivery, injects the record with her signature grit and confidence. Yung Miami, one half of the multi-platinum duo City Girls and a cultural tastemaker in her own right, adds a sharp, charismatic verse that complements the track's bold tone. Meanwhile, Atlanta's rising artist YKNIECE continues to build her profile, contributing a fresh perspective that rounds out the collaboration.
The remix arrives as "POP DAT THANG" reaches a major milestone, climbing to No. 1 at Urban Radio this week via Mediabase, further solidifying its position as a dominant force across airwaves. The single continues to perform strongly across Billboard charts, currently sitting at No. 30 on the Hot 100, No. 6 on R&B/Hip-Hop Airplay, No. 2 on Rap Airplay, No. 6 on Hot R&B/Hip-Hop Songs, No. 2 on Hot Rap Songs, and No. 9 on Rhythmic Airplay.
The original "POP DAT THANG" has become a defining record from DaBaby's latest album BE MORE GRATEFUL, blending fast-paced production with his unmistakable delivery and club-ready energy. The remix expands that momentum, turning the track into a full-scale anthem that reflects the current energy across the culture.
The release comes as DaBaby continues his 'BE MORE GRATEFUL' Tour, bringing the album's energy directly to fans through a series of intimate, high-demand shows across the country. In addition to the tour, he is also preparing to host his upcoming 'Be More Grateful Festival' in Charlotte on June 13, further extending his impact in his hometown community.
Released earlier this year, BE MORE GRATEFUL debuted No. 6 on Billboard's Top Rap Albums, No. 9 on Top R&B/Hip-Hop Albums, and No. 25 on the Billboard 200, moving 24,000 units in its first week. The 23-track project showcases DaBaby balancing high-energy anthems with more personal records centered on growth, family, and reflection.
An 8-time GRAMMY nominee with more than 38 billion global streams, DaBaby continues to cement his place as one of hip-hop's most consistent hitmakers. With a catalog that includes the seven-week No. 1 smash "ROCKSTAR," his sustained success has earned him the fan-given nickname "Billboard Baby."
